What does the Bible say about reasonable service to God?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ible teaches that presenting our bodies as living sacrifices is our reasonable service to God.

In Romans 12:1-2, Paul urges believers to present their bodies as a living sacrifice, holy and acceptable to God, which is described as their reasonable service. This act is an intelligent response to the mercies of God, reflecting the entirety of the gospel message. It signifies a total commitment to God, transcending mere actions to embody our spiritual worship. This commitment is our only proper response to the grace and mercy we've received through Christ.
Scripture References: Romans 12:1-2, Romans 4:5
